- Samuel TAYLOR a Rev. soldier in the VA line drew pension
in Sullivan Co. TN. He was b. 1748 d. after 1840. Was living
with son, Edmund TAYLOR in Sullivan Co. This info from "Taylors
of TN" by Zella Armstrong. Trying to link Samuel TAYLOR
who prob. m. Sophie CREED to my Hezekiah TAYLOR of Overton TN,
the son of Edmund/Edward TAYLOR who was m. to Elizabeth "Betsy"
---maiden name? TAYLOR. Edmund (abt 1760-1824), he died in Campbell
Co. VA and his survivors including wife Elizabeth, ch: Chesley,
Pleasant, David, Hezekiah, Spicey, Massey who m. PRYORS, Polly,
Jane and Elizabeth (minor in 1824) moved to Sumner Co. TN and
Overton Co. TN Allied families in Overton and Sumner: MARKHAM,
CREED, ELLIS, GILES, GARRETT, PRYOR, AMMONETT, RICHARDSON. Snailmail:

- I am looking for information on the HARLEY, STAFFORD and
SWEARENGIN families in Jackson, Overton, and Putnam Counties.
These families apparently came from North Carolina to Tennessee
at an early date and there were many marriages between them.
I am especially interested in the ancestors of Robert and Joseph
SWEARENGIN who were enumerated with Hiram and Elizabeth STAFFORD
HARLEY (of Jackson County, Tn.) on the 1860 census in Webster
County, Missouri. These children were born in about 1851/52 and
1856/57 respectively, Robert listed as born in Tennessee and
Joseph listed as born in Missouri.On Joseph's death certificate
his parents are listed as John E. SWEARENGIN and his mother as_______
HARLEY. It is known that Elizabeth HARLEY, daughter of Hiram
and Elizabeth STAFFORD HARLEY married Hugh SWEARENGIN and that
they moved to Greene, then to Webster County, Missouri sometime
before the 1860! census was taken.

- About 1824 after completing medical training, Samuel
and Mary Ann BENDER moved to Overton Co. In 1842, with eight
children, they moved to Missouri where Samuel practiced medicine.
A son, Alexander Campbell BENDER remained in Overton Co. where
about 1848/50, he married Rachel ALLEN, the daughter of Josiah
ALLEN and Sarah DALE. Josiah was the son of William ALLEN and
Mary COPELAND. Sarah was the daughter of William DALE and Rachel
IRONS. I would like to exchange information with others who are
interested in the BENDER, ALLEN, DALE, COPELAND and IRONS families,
